Feeling overwhelmed ? Locating support for your anxiety can seem difficult , but it doesn’t have to be! Many resources are available to help you connect with qualified professionals in your area. Start by using online directories like Psychology Today, GoodTherapy, or Open Path Collective. These platforms allow you to refine your search based on area, insurance, specialties , and particular needs. You can also consult your primary care doctor for referrals or explore with your insurance provider for a list of in-network therapists . What to Expect from Anxiety Counseling Sessions
Your beginning anxiety counseling can feel challenging, but understanding the to anticipate can ease some worry. Generally, your opening appointment will involve the talk about your history, the reasons contributing to your anxiety, and your goals for recovery. You'll perhaps be asked to discuss your experiences and current challenges. Subsequent meetings may incorporate various techniques, such as cognitive rational treatment, relaxation methods, or awareness practices. Remember that building an trusting rapport with your therapist is important to successful outcomes.

Anxiety Counseling: Understanding Your Options
Feeling nervous about dealing with anxiety? Getting expert counseling can be a powerful step towards better well-being. There are numerous different types of anxiety counseling offered, including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) , which helps you identify and modify negative patterns; exposure therapy, a gradual approach for confronting anxieties; and mindfulness-based therapy or mindfulness approaches, emphasizing being in the present. Locating the right counselor and method is crucial to feeling better, so investigate your options and don't hesitate to learn about their background before proceeding to treatment .
